J-Hope is back and ready to shine on his first-ever North American solo tour, Hope On the Stage!
The 30-year-old BTS star revealed the exciting news just months after completing his mandatory 18-month military service in South Korea in October 2024. This marks a significant milestone for J-Hope, as it’s his debut solo tour across North America.
The tour will take him to major cities like Brooklyn, Chicago, Mexico City, San Antonio, and Oakland, with an epic finale featuring his first solo headlining stadium performances in Los Angeles. Fans can expect a high-energy, unforgettable experience showcasing J-Hope’s signature talent and charisma.
Fans with ARMY Membership will get first dibs on tickets, starting Wednesday, January 22, at 3 p.m. local time. To join in, ARMY members can register on Weverse now through Sunday, January 19, to verify their membership ahead of the presale.
If you miss the presale, don’t worry—general ticket sales kick off Thursday, January 23, at 3 p.m. local time on LiveNation.com. However, tickets for the Los Angeles shows will go on sale later due to the ongoing wildfires in the area.

Check out the j-hope Hope On the Stage North American tour dates…
Thu Mar 13 – Brooklyn, NY – Barclays Center
Fri Mar 14 – Brooklyn, NY – Barclays Center
Mon Mar 17 – Chicago, IL – Allstate Arena
Tue Mar 18 – Chicago, IL – Allstate Arena
Sat Mar 22 – Mexico City, MX – Palacio de los Deportes
Sun Mar 23 – Mexico City, MX – Palacio de los Deportes
Wed Mar 26 – San Antonio, TX – Frost Bank Center
Thu Mar 27 – San Antonio, TX – Frost Bank Center
Mon Mar 31 – Oakland, CA – Oakland Arena
Tue Apr 01 – Oakland, CA – Oakland Arena
Fri Apr 4 – Los Angeles, CA – BMO Stadium
Sun Apr 6 – Los Angeles, CA – BMO Stadium
